Nutritional Needs of a Maltipoo Puppy
Maltipoo puppies are small in size but have big nutritional needs. They require a high-quality, well-balanced diet to fuel their growth, energy, and overall development. While individual needs can vary based on activity level, age, and any specific health concerns, there are several core nutrients that are essential for all Maltipoo puppies:
1. Protein
Protein is the most important nutrient for growing puppies. It supports muscle development, tissue repair, and overall growth. A Maltipoo puppy, like all puppies, requires protein in their diet to help build the foundation of strong muscles and a healthy immune system.
Ideal Sources: Look for high-quality animal-based protein sources, such as chicken, turkey, lamb, or fish. These provide amino acids that are essential for a developing puppy.
Protein Percentage: Maltipoo puppies should consume about 20-30% protein in their food, depending on their specific needs and growth stage. This ensures that their muscles and organs develop properly.
2. Fats
Fat is an important energy source for puppies, especially active ones like the Maltipoo. Fats also play a crucial role in skin and coat health, brain development, and cell function.
Ideal Sources: Omega-3 and Omega-6 fatty acids are especially important for brain health, skin, and coat quality. Look for foods that include fish oils, flaxseed, or chicken fat.
Fat Percentage: A Maltipoo puppy’s diet should contain about 8-15% fat, though this can vary based on activity levels. High-energy puppies or those with more intense exercise needs may require slightly higher fat levels.
3. Carbohydrates
Carbohydrates provide essential energy for Maltipoo puppies. They also aid in digestion and help maintain stable blood sugar levels.
Ideal Sources: Opt for digestible sources of carbohydrates like sweet potatoes, brown rice, quinoa, or oatmeal. These provide long-lasting energy without causing digestive upset.
Carbohydrate Percentage: While the primary focus for Maltipoo food should be protein and fat, carbohydrates should make up 30-50% of the food’s composition.
4. Vitamins and Minerals
Puppies require vitamins and minerals to support their immune system, bone health, and overall development. These micronutrients help maintain healthy vision, skin, and coat, as well as regulate the metabolism.
Ideal Sources: A good puppy food should include essential vitamins like vitamin A, C, D, and E, as well as minerals such as calcium, phosphorus, and magnesium.
Calcium-to-Phosphorus Ratio: For puppies, especially small breeds like the Maltipoo, it is essential to have a balanced calcium-to-phosphorus ratio, ideally 1.2:1. This ensures healthy bone growth and reduces the risk of bone-related issues.
5. Fiber
Fiber aids in digestion and helps prevent common digestive issues like constipation and diarrhea. Small breed puppies, including Maltipoos, need a moderate amount of fiber in their diet to maintain gastrointestinal health.
Ideal Sources: Look for foods that include fiber-rich ingredients like beet pulp, pumpkin, or chicory root. These ingredients are easy for puppies to digest and help regulate bowel movements.
Fiber Percentage: A Maltipoo puppy’s food should contain about 2-4% fiber to ensure good digestive health.
Factors to Consider When Choosing Puppy Food for Maltipoo
In addition to the core nutrients, there are several other factors to consider when selecting food for your Maltipoo puppy:
1. Size and Breed-Specific Formulas
Maltipoos are a small breed, so choosing a food formulated specifically for small breed puppies is important. Small breed puppy food is designed to meet their higher energy needs and smaller mouths. It also ensures that the kibble is the right size for their tiny jaws, making it easier for them to eat.
2. Age of the Puppy
The nutritional needs of a Maltipoo change as they grow. Puppy food is formulated to support the rapid growth phase that occurs in the first 6-12 months of life. After that, you can transition to adult food that’s lower in calories and designed to maintain weight and health.
3. Health Considerations
Maltipoos are prone to certain health issues like allergies, dental problems, and joint issues. Choosing food that addresses these concerns can be beneficial:
Allergy-Friendly Ingredients: Some Maltipoos may develop food allergies or sensitivities to common ingredients like chicken or grain. Look for hypoallergenic food options or formulas that avoid common allergens.
Dental Health: Maltipoos are prone to dental issues due to their small mouths and teeth. Foods with added dental benefits, such as crunchy kibble, can help promote better oral hygiene.
Joint Health: If your Maltipoo has a history of joint issues, such as hip dysplasia, foods with added glucosamine and chondroitin can help support their joint health and mobility.
4. Ingredients to Avoid
When choosing food for your Maltipoo, avoid ingredients that could cause digestive issues or contribute to allergies. These include:
Fillers like corn, soy, or wheat: These ingredients provide little nutritional value and can lead to allergies or digestive upset.
Artificial preservatives or colors: Look for food that is free of artificial additives, which are unnecessary and potentially harmful to your puppy’s health.
5. Brand Reputation and Quality
Choosing a well-known, trusted brand can make a big difference in ensuring your Maltipoo gets the best quality food. Look for brands that use high-quality, whole food ingredients, and those that are AAFCO-certified. This certification means that the food meets the minimum nutritional standards for pets.
